This chess game between Aleksandr Demchenko (1940) and Alfred Parvanyan (2140) was played at 1. Munich Pfingst-Open A in 2023 and finished 1-0. The opening was the Sicilian Defense: Nyezhmetdinov-Rossolimo Attack, Fianchetto Variation (B31).
